Where Did Tony Balkissoon Go to School?
Tony’s education is one of the clearest parts of his public story.
Before becoming a lawyer, he studied Engineering Science at the University of Toronto. His current law firm says he earned a Bachelor of Applied Science degree with honors.
That may sound surprising because engineering and law are very different fields.
Think about it like this. Engineering teaches people to study difficult problems carefully and find logical answers. Those same skills can also be useful when reading complicated laws and building legal arguments.
After university in Canada, Tony attended Harvard Law School. He earned his law degree there cum laude, which means he graduated with high academic honors.

When Did Tony Balkissoon and Laura Jarrett Get Married?
Tony and Laura married in June 2012 in Chicago.
The ceremony received unusual attention because Laura is the daughter of Valerie Jarrett, who served as a senior adviser to President Barack Obama.
President Obama, Michelle Obama, their daughters, and other important guests attended the wedding. CBS Chicago reported at the time that the celebration took place near the Obama family’s Chicago home.
An archived official White House photograph also shows Laura and Tony taking their vows while Michelle Obama watched the ceremony.

Is Tony Balkissoon Still at John Jay College?
This is one of the biggest points of confusion about Tony Balkissoon online.
In February 2020, John Jay College of Criminal Justice announced that Tony had joined the school as Vice President and Executive Counsel. The college said he would advise leaders on matters such as court cases, school rules, regulatory issues, employment agreements, and intellectual property.
John Jay records from later years continued to show him serving in senior legal roles at the college.
However, Tony’s current law-firm biography says he joined NSBHF in January 2024. The firm’s current team page continues to list him as counsel.
So, the simple answer is this:
No, his most recently verified professional role is not at John Jay College. He is now working as counsel at NSBHF.

What Kind of Legal Cases Has Tony Balkissoon Worked On?
Tony’s legal career has included major civil rights cases.
His firm says he was part of small trial teams that won jury awards of $22 million and $15 million for people who had been wrongfully convicted. He also helped defend those results during appeals.
Additionally, his biography says he worked with a small nonprofit appeals team on a case that reached the U.S. Supreme Court.
He has also represented people who said their constitutional rights were violated while they were in prison.
More recently, Tony was listed as part of the legal team representing Daniel Saldaña. In November 2025, the City of Baldwin Park agreed to a $19.1 million settlement in Saldaña’s wrongful-conviction case after he had spent decades dealing with the effects of a conviction later found to be wrongful.
Tony was one member of a larger legal team, so it would be wrong to give him all the credit. Still, the case shows the type of serious civil rights work he continues to be connected with.
Did Tony Balkissoon Work as a Court Clerk?
Yes.
His current professional biography lists two federal judicial clerkships.
Tony clerked for Judge Manish S. Shah of the U.S. District Court for the Northern District of Illinois. He also clerked for retired Judge Ann Claire Williams of the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Seventh Circuit.
A judicial clerk works closely with a judge.
The clerk may research laws, study legal arguments, and help the court understand difficult questions.
For a young lawyer, this kind of experience can offer a close look at how judges make decisions.
Who Is Tony Balkissoon’s Father?
Tony is the son of Bas Balkissoon, a former Canadian politician.
Bas served for many years in public office in Toronto and Ontario. He was a Toronto-area municipal politician before becoming a member of Ontario’s provincial legislature for Scarborough—Rouge River.
Bas was born in Trinidad and Tobago and later built his life and political career in Canada.
Therefore, Tony grew up with a close family connection to public service and politics.
However, Tony did not follow his father directly into elected politics.
Instead, he chose law.
That difference is important. While his father worked inside government, Tony built a career dealing with courts, civil rights, and legal questions.
